If you're waking up to streaming windows, patches of moisture on the walls, or mould appearing in corners and behind furniture, you're dealing with one of Glasgow's most common housing problems. Glasgow's housing is defined by its sandstone tenements, the red and blonde stone flats found right across the city from Partick and Shawlands to Dennistoun and the West End.

These buildings have real character, but their solid stone walls and original design manage moisture very differently from modern housing. Many have been upgraded over the years with double glazing, draught-proofing and added insulation, all sensible improvements on their own, but when ventilation isn't updated at the same time, moisture from everyday life gets trapped inside the flat with no clear way out. Add Glasgow's high rainfall and damp climate, and the result is condensation forming on the coldest surfaces, then mould following close behind.

Bungalows and ground-floor flats face the same issue from a different angle. With all the living space on a single level, moisture from cooking, washing, drying clothes and simply breathing builds up quickly, and without adequate airflow it has nowhere to go. Condensation can look straightforward but its cause is often less obvious. What works in one Glasgow flat can make things worse in another, which is why the right diagnosis matters before anything else.

For Private Landlords in Glasgow

Condensation and moisture in rental property is now a legal priority in Scotland, not just a maintenance issue. Scotland's equivalent to Awaab's Law is confirmed to come into force covering the private rented sector from 6 October 2026, introducing strict timeframes for investigating and resolving damp and mould in rented homes.

For Glasgow's private landlords, that deadline is months away, not years. So much of the city's rental stock sits within older sandstone tenements, the property type most prone to condensation, and the one most likely to prompt a complaint when a tenant notices mould.

Getting the right ventilation in place before October is the most straightforward way to protect your tenants, your property and your compliance position.
